a safer alternative replacement for thiourea based accelerators in the,ethylene thiourea (etu) has been used as accelerator in production of chloroprene rubber for decades. etu is classified as cmr (carcinogenic, mutagenic or toxic to reproduction) and is thereby a substance that could identified as a substance of very high concern and afterwards included in annex xiv of reach (authorisation).

good quality etu (na-22) rubber accelerators rubber chemicals.nurcacit etu (na-22) chemical name: ethylene thiourea. cas no.: 96-45-7. etu is a special curing accelerator for chloroprene rubber of ch and w, epichlorohydrin rubber and polyacrylate rubber, suitable for wire, cable, rubber belt and tube, rubber shoes, rubber coat and so on, also suitable for intermediate products of fine chemicals.
